Jesus before Pilate
11
Meanwhile Jesus stood before the governor, who questioned Him: “Are You the King of the Jews?”
1
“You have said so,” Jesus replied.
12
And when He was accused by the chief priests and elders, He gave no answer.
13
Then Pilate asked Him, “Do You not hear how many charges they are bringing against You?”
14
But Jesus gave no answer, not even to a single charge, much to the governor’s amazement.
